Understanding software applications involves exploring various licensing models, such as perpetual, subscription, freemium, open-source, and site licensing. Each model presents unique benefits and challenges that affect user access and payment structures. Subscription fees, typically charged on a recurring basis, can vary widely depending on the chosen model, while freemium approaches entice users with free basic features and paid premium options.

What are the main software licensing models?

What are the main software licensing models?

The main software licensing models include perpetual licensing, subscription licensing, freemium models, open-source licensing, and site licensing. Each model offers distinct advantages and considerations, influencing how users access and pay for software.

Perpetual licensing

Perpetual licensing allows users to purchase software outright, granting them indefinite use. This model typically involves a one-time payment, which can range from hundreds to thousands of dollars depending on the software’s complexity and functionality.

While perpetual licenses provide long-term ownership, they may require additional fees for updates or support. Users should evaluate whether the upfront cost aligns with their long-term needs and budget.

Subscription licensing

Subscription licensing involves paying a recurring fee, usually monthly or annually, to use the software. This model often includes updates and support as part of the subscription, which can range from a few dollars to several hundred dollars per month.

Subscription licensing offers flexibility and lower initial costs, making it attractive for businesses that prefer predictable budgeting. However, users must consider the total cost over time, as ongoing payments can exceed the cost of a perpetual license.

Freemium model

The freemium model provides basic software features for free while charging for advanced functionalities or additional services. This approach allows users to try the software without commitment, often leading to a conversion to paid plans.

While freemium models can attract a large user base, they may lead to frustration if essential features are locked behind paywalls. Users should assess whether the free version meets their needs before investing in premium options.

Open-source licensing

Open-source licensing allows users to access, modify, and distribute the software’s source code. This model promotes collaboration and innovation, with many open-source projects available at no cost.

While open-source software can be highly customizable, users may need technical expertise to implement changes. Additionally, support may be limited compared to commercial software, so businesses should weigh the benefits against potential challenges.

Site licensing

Site licensing permits an organization to use software across multiple devices or users within a specific location, typically for a flat fee. This model is common in educational institutions and large enterprises, where software needs to be deployed widely.

Site licenses can offer significant cost savings compared to purchasing individual licenses, but organizations should ensure compliance with licensing terms. It’s essential to evaluate the total number of users and devices to determine the most cost-effective licensing strategy.

How do subscription fees work for software applications?

How do subscription fees work for software applications?

Subscription fees for software applications are recurring charges that users pay to access and use the software over a specified period. These fees can vary based on the subscription model, which may include monthly, annual, or usage-based pricing structures.

Monthly subscription fees

Monthly subscription fees are charged on a month-to-month basis, allowing users to pay for software access without a long-term commitment. This model is often preferred by individuals or small businesses that want flexibility and the ability to cancel at any time.

Typical monthly fees can range from a few dollars to several hundred, depending on the software’s complexity and features. Users should consider their budget and the software’s value before committing to a monthly plan.

Annual subscription fees

Annual subscription fees are charged once a year and often come with a discount compared to monthly payments. This model is suitable for users who are confident in their long-term need for the software and want to save money over time.

Annual fees can vary widely, from around $50 to several thousand dollars, depending on the software’s capabilities. Users should evaluate their usage patterns and potential savings when choosing between monthly and annual options.

Usage-based pricing

Usage-based pricing charges users based on their actual usage of the software, making it a flexible option for those whose needs may fluctuate. This model is common in cloud services and applications where resource consumption can vary significantly.

Pricing can be structured around metrics such as the number of users, transactions, or data storage. Users should carefully monitor their usage to avoid unexpected costs and ensure they choose a plan that aligns with their actual needs.

What are the benefits of freemium software models?

What are the benefits of freemium software models?

Freemium software models provide users with free access to basic features while offering premium functionalities for a fee. This approach attracts a larger user base, allowing companies to monetize through upgrades and additional services.

Low entry barrier for users

The freemium model significantly lowers the entry barrier for users, as they can try the software without any financial commitment. This accessibility encourages more users to sign up, increasing the potential customer base for the company.

For example, a productivity app might offer essential features for free, allowing users to test its effectiveness before deciding to invest in advanced tools. This strategy can lead to higher user engagement and retention rates.

Potential for upselling

Freemium models create opportunities for upselling premium features to existing users. Once users are familiar with the basic functionalities, they may be more inclined to purchase additional features that enhance their experience.

Companies can implement targeted marketing strategies, such as in-app notifications or email campaigns, to promote premium upgrades. Offering limited-time discounts or exclusive features can further incentivize users to transition from free to paid plans.

User feedback for product improvement

Freemium models allow companies to gather valuable user feedback, which is essential for product improvement. With a larger user base, developers can identify common pain points and preferences, leading to more informed updates and enhancements.

Encouraging users to provide feedback through surveys or in-app prompts can help prioritize feature development. Companies that actively listen to their users are more likely to create products that meet market demands and foster customer loyalty.

What factors influence software licensing decisions?

What factors influence software licensing decisions?

Software licensing decisions are influenced by various factors including the size and specific needs of the business, budget constraints, and compliance and security requirements. Understanding these elements can help organizations choose the most suitable licensing model for their operations.

Business size and needs

The size of a business significantly impacts its software licensing decisions. Small businesses may prefer flexible, lower-cost options like subscription models or freemium services, while larger enterprises often require comprehensive licenses that support multiple users and advanced features.

Additionally, the specific needs of a business, such as the type of software required for operations or the number of users, play a crucial role. For instance, a company in the tech sector might need robust development tools, while a retail business may prioritize point-of-sale systems.

Budget constraints

Budget constraints are a critical factor in software licensing decisions. Organizations must evaluate the total cost of ownership, which includes not only the initial purchase price but also ongoing maintenance, support, and potential upgrade costs.

For businesses with limited budgets, opting for subscription-based models can provide flexibility and lower upfront costs. However, it’s essential to assess whether long-term subscription fees might exceed the cost of a one-time purchase over time.

Compliance and security requirements

Compliance and security requirements can heavily influence software licensing choices. Many industries have specific regulations that dictate how software must be used and maintained, which can affect the type of license a business should pursue.

For example, organizations in the healthcare or finance sectors must ensure that their software complies with strict data protection regulations. This may lead them to choose licenses that offer enhanced security features or regular updates to meet compliance standards.

How do companies choose between licensing models?

How do companies choose between licensing models?

Companies choose between licensing models based on their business goals, target audience, and the nature of their software. Factors such as market demand, revenue potential, and user engagement play crucial roles in this decision-making process.

Market research and analysis

Conducting thorough market research is essential for companies to understand customer preferences and competitive offerings. This involves analyzing trends in software usage, identifying target demographics, and evaluating competitors’ licensing strategies. For instance, a company may find that a subscription model is more appealing in a market where users prefer lower upfront costs.

Additionally, surveys and focus groups can provide valuable insights into user willingness to pay and desired features. Companies should consider regional differences, as preferences for licensing models can vary significantly across different countries or cultures.

Cost-benefit analysis

Performing a cost-benefit analysis helps companies weigh the financial implications of different licensing models. This analysis should include projected revenue, development costs, and customer acquisition expenses. For example, a freemium model may attract a larger user base but could lead to higher costs in support and conversion efforts.

Companies should also consider the long-term sustainability of each model. Subscription fees can provide steady income, while one-time licenses may lead to fluctuating revenue. Evaluating these factors can help businesses select a model that aligns with their financial goals and market conditions.

By Liora Voss

Liora Voss is a tech enthusiast and mobile OS expert, dedicated to exploring the latest trends in app development and operating systems. With a background in software engineering, she combines her passion for technology with a flair for writing, making complex topics accessible to all. When she's not analyzing the latest mobile innovations, Liora enjoys hiking and photography.

Leave a Reply

Your email address will not be published. Required fields are marked *